air emergency in the national capital, the Union Health Ministry on Friday issued an advisory for children in Delhi and neighbouring states amid mounting pollution concerns and toxic air days that have emerged as a clear and present danger to public health. However, in a measure of respite from the smog or toxic cloud that has been hanging heavy over the national capital in the last week and more, the city on Friday received showers that saw the overall Air Quality Index (AQI) drop below 400. The Central Pollution Control Board (CPCB) pegged the city's overall AQI at 398 at 10.30 am on Friday. The central health advisory on Friday laid particular emphasis on children, as it advised school authorities, heads, teachers as well as parents to develop mechanisms to create awareness and motivate students to adopt better practices to mitigate and adapt to air pollution. The ministry said schools should organise awareness events and award children for taking up mitigation practices to fight air pollution. «Areas: Cities and urban areas are more likely to have outside pollution levels.

Taiwan with a plan to send tens of thousands of workers to the island as early as next month, according to senior officials familiar with the matter, potentially angering neighbor China. Taiwan could hire as many as 100,000 Indians to work at factories, farms and hospitals, the officials said, asking not to be identified as the discussions are private. The two sides are expected to sign an employment mobility agreement by as early as December, the people said. Taiwan’s aging society means it needs more workers, while in India, the economy isn’t growing fast enough to create enough jobs for the millions of young people who enter the labor market every year.

The prolific gang known as Lockbit is suspected to have orchestrated a ransomware attack against the US unit of ICBC, the world’s largest lender by assets, according to people familiar with the situation, who asked not to be identified because the information isn’t public. The attack has resulted in disruptions across the US Treasury market, with some transactions failing to clear and traders being asked to reroute their deals. Lockbit, a criminal gang with ties to Russia, specializes in using malicious software known as ransomware to encrypt files on its victims’ computers, then demanding payment to unlock the files.

Experts hospital reports patient Medanta reports 46% jump in net profit to Rs 125 crore in Q2FY24
Global Health (Medanta) reported a 46% year-on-year (YoY) jump in net profit to Rs 125 in Q2FY24 due to an increase in revenue growth from matured and new hospitals, along with higher patient volumes. Revenue rose 24.5% YoY to Rs 865 crore. The earnings before interest, tax, depreciation and ammortisation (EBITDA) rose 35.7% YoY to Rs 234 crore. The EBITDA margins expanded 220 basis points YoY to 27%. Average occupied bed days increased by 17.8% y-o-y, representing an occupancy of 64.9% in Q2 FY24. Average revenue per occupied bed (ARPOB) grew by 4.8% y-o-y to Rs 61,003; in-patient volume increased by 19.4% and out-patient volume increased by 23.2% y-o-y.
